Designed by architect Francisco Isidro Monteiro, the João Caetano Theater was built in wood covered with stucco, occupying an area of 870 m² with capacity for 800 spectators. Several plays by dramatist Arthur Azevedo (1855–1908) were staged in a comfortable space organized to accommodate the audience, with a gallery displaying artworks and boxes for artists. The interior decoration, in shades of green with gilded capitals, was striking from an architectural point of view, especially considering it was entirely built of wood and stucco
